Orion Network Performance Monitor Multiple Cross-Site Scripting Vulnerabilities


Description   Multiple vulnerabilities have been reported in Orion Network Performance Monitor, which can be exploited by malicious people to conduct cross-site scripting attacks.
Input passed to the "Title" parameter in MapView.aspx (when "Map" is set to any value), "NetObject" parameter in NodeDetails.aspx and InterfaceDetails.aspx, and "ChartName" parameter in CustomChart.aspx is not properly sanitised before being returned to the user. This can be exploited to execute arbitrary HTML and script code in a user's browser session in context of an affected site.
The vulnerabilities are reported in version 10.1. Other versions may also be affected.
     
Vulnerable Products   Vulnerable Software:
Orion Network Performance Monitor 10.x
     
Solution   Filter malicious characters and character sequences in a proxy.
     
CVE   CVE-2010-4828
